Vancouver, British Columbia – July 11th, 2025 – Terra Balcanica Resources Corp. (“Terra” or
the “Company”) (CSE:TERA; FRA:UB1) is pleased to announce the closing of the first tranche
of its non-brokered, listed issuer financing exemption private placement (the “Private Placement”
or “Offering”) for gross proceeds of C$814,914 through the issuance of 8,149,141 units (each a
“Unit”) at a purchase price of C$0.10 per Unit. Each Unit is comprised of one common share in
the capital of the Company ( “Common Share”) and one -half of one Common Share purchase
warrant (each whole warrant, a “Warrant”). Each Warrant is exercisable to purchase one
Common Share (“Warrant Share”) at an exercise price of C$0.20 per Warrant Share for a period
of 24 months from the closing date of the Private Placement or its respective tranches (the “Closing
Date”). Finders’ fees in the amount of $28,000 were paid.
The Company also announces that it is extending the final Closing Date of the Private Placement,
to raise up to total gross proceeds of C$1,117,495, to on or before August 11th, 2025. A second
amended and restated offering document has been filed on under the Company’s profile at the
www.sedarplus.ca website and on the Company’s webpage at www.terrabresources.com . The
Private Placement is subject to the approval by the Canadian Securities Exchange (the “CSE”).
See the Company’s press release dated April 16 th, 2025 for further details regarding the Private
Placement.

Exercising 1st Year of the Uranium Option Agreement
Pursuant to the definitive option agreement signed with Fulcrum Metals Plc. and Fulcrum Metals
(Canada) Ltd. (collectively “Fulcrum ”) on the 3 rd of July, 2024 (the “Agreement”), Terra has
determined to exercise its right to complete the 1st year of the option conditions required for Terra
to acquire a 100% interest in the Fulcrum’s Charlot- Neely Lake, Fontaine Lake, Snowbird, and
South Pendleton licence clusters located along northern and southeastern margins of the renowned
Athabasca Basin. In consideration for exercising the 1st year of the option conditions, Terra will
pay Fulcrum C$50,000 in cash and issue Fulcrum Metals (Canada) Ltd. C$350,000 of Terra
common shares at the 10 -day volume weighted average trading price ending three trading days
prior to the date of issuance, subject to the minimum pricing requirements of the CSE. The
common shares of the Company issued in connection with the Agreement are subject to a hold
period of four months from the date of issuance in accordance with applicable securities laws in
Canada and the policies of the CSE. See the Company’s press release dated July 3, 2024 for further
details regarding the Agreement.

About the Company
Terra Balcanica is a polymetallic and energy metals exploration company targeting large -scale
mineral systems in the Balkans of southeastern Europe and norther n Saskatchewan, Canada. The
Company has a 90% interest in the Viogor-Zanik Project in eastern Bosnia and Herzegovina. The
Canadian assets comprise a 100% optioned portfolio of uranium -prospective licences at the
outskirts of the Athabasca basin: Charlot -Neely Lake, Fontaine Lake, Snowbird, and South
Pendleton. The Company emphasizes responsible engagement with local communities and
stakeholders. It is committed to proactively implementing Good Interna tional Industry Practice
(GIIP) and sustainable health, safety, and environmental management.
